Rusiate Namoro (born Naitasiri[2]) is a former Fijian rugby player. He played as a hooker and prop. Along with Koli Rakoroi, Elia Rokowailoa, Tom Mitchell, Epeli Naituivau and Setareki Tawake, he was one of the eight members of the country's armed forces to play for Fiji in a Rugby World Cup squad[3].

Career

His first cap for Fiji was against Samoa, at Suva, on 21 August 1982. He also was called up for the 1987 Rugby World Cup roster, where he played 2 matches, where his last international cap was against the quarter-final against France, at Auckland.
